Yellowjackets. A high school girls soccer team is flying to a tournament. Plane crashes in Canada wilderness. Survival mode for 19 months. It follows both 1996 and present today in covering story. A showtime series.

I watched a doumentary on the Everly Brothers, "Harmonies from Heaven". Good stuff! They interviewed the elder brother Don (this was in 2014), had previous interview footage with Phil who'd already passed away, and the married couple who wrote their hits for them - the first full time song writing duo in Nashville. Super interesting! Also interviewed : Keith Richards, Art Garfunkel, Tim Rice etc on how the Everly Brothers influenced them.
Apparently the Everly Brothers dort of saved Warner Bros. When they switched to the newly formed Warner Bros music fivision (for $1 million which was huuuuge back then) Warner was not doing well with movies and soundtracks at all. The Everly Brothers delivered immediately with "Cathy's Clown"
Meanwhile their old record company was still releasing new singles as well so the Everly Brothers were in competition with themselves lol
When they were drafted and afterwards changed management (and their old manager no longer gave them access to th song writing duo NOR could they write their own songs anymore either because they had signed away their song writing to the old manager lol) things fell apart. Crying in the rain by Carole King was their last hit.
The close harmony singing was exolained really well from a musical/technical point if view as were their folk and country music roots.
